Singularity stores grid properties in some internal variable.
Whenever you use add-grid()
, this variable is updated with new grid properties.
If you use add-grid()
once, all Singularity spanning mixins called below will use that definition.
What happens when you use add-grid()
again? It will not affect the code above. But the code below will use the new definition of the grid.
Thus, there are two strategies of using add-grid()
:
- Use it once to set one definition all the time.
- If you need different grids, use
add-grid()
every time before calling a Singularity spanning mixin. This will ensure that each mixin uses an appropriate grid definition.
The latter is probably not an intended way of doing things, but if you've got multiple grids to work with, you've got no other option.

How Singularity stores its settings
Singularity 1.2 stores its settings in the $singularity
map. It uses the sgs-get()
and sgs-set()
functions to access those settings. The funny thing with functions is that you can't use them withough assigning a value somewhere, so you can't do:
sgs-set('foo', 'bar')
You have to assign the result of the function to a dummy variable, even if you're not going to reuse that anywhere:
$dummy: sgs-set('foo', 'bar')
How to manually reassign grid definitions
Grids and gutters are stored under 'grids'
and 'gutters'
keys of the $singularity
map. So in order to mix multiple grids on the same page you have to reset those.
Luckily, there is sgs-reset()
that exists both in function and mixin forms.
So before declaring a different grid, you have to reset existing grid:
+sgs-reset(grids)
+sgs-reset(gutters)
+add-grid(2 4 2)
+add-gutter(0.2)
A custom mixin to quickly reassign grids
That is a fair amount of work. You can make it easier with a custom mixin:
=reset-grid($grid: 2, $gutter: 0.1)
+sgs-reset(grids)
+sgs-reset(gutters)
+add-grid($grid)
+add-gutter($gutter)
Here's a usage example:
.container-1
+reset-grid()
#foo
+grid-span(1,1)
#bar
+grid-span(1,2)
.container-2
+reset-grid(1 3 2, 0.2)
#baz
+grid-span(1,1)
#quux
+grid-span(2,2)
Resulting CSS: http://sassmeister.com/gist/21249a9dabf745f892cb
Note that if you use the approach of resetting your grids once in your project, you HAVE to use it everywhere in your project. If you don't apply reset prior to every spanning, you might have unpredictable results.
That's because you no longer have a standard site-wide grid and you have to tell Singularity which grid you mean to use every time you ask Singularity to span anything.
Manually using that mixin inside media queries instead of maintaining a complex grid definition
On the other hand, once you're resetting your grids all the time, you no longer need to define media query-aware grids. I find this to be a relief. Managing the consitency of a complex grids hierarchy can be a nuisance.
.container-1
+reset-grid()
#foo
+grid-span(1,1)
#bar
+grid-span(1,2)
+breakpoint(700px)
+reset-grid(3, 0.2)
#foo
+grid-span(2,1)
#bar
+grid-span(1,2)

A custom mixin to quickly span a thumbnail grid
You can save yourself even more time if you're doing a lot of thumbnail grids, as opposed to page layouts. Here's a mixin that generates a thumbnail grid for a given number of columns (works with symmetrical grids only):
=quick-span($cols, $guts: 0.1, $pseudoclass: child, $center-last-row: 20, $proportional-margins: true)
+reset-grid($cols, $guts)
@for $i from 1 through $cols
&:nth-#{$pseudoclass}(#{$cols}n+#{$i})
+float-span(1, $i)
@if $i == 1
clear: both
@if $proportional-margins
&:nth-last-#{$pseudoclass}(#{$i})
margin-bottom: 0
@if $proportional-margins
margin-bottom: $guts / ( $cols + ($cols - 1) * $guts) * 100%
// Centering the last row
@if $center-last-row and $cols < $center-last-row
@for $i from 1 through $center-last-row
$remainder: $i % $cols
&:nth-#{$pseudoclass}(#{$i - $remainder + 1}):nth-last-child(#{$remainder})
margin-left: grid-span(1, 1) * ($cols - $remainder) / 2

A custom mixin to set up a responsive thumbnail grid with a snap of fingers
Finally, you can put this looping mixin in a one more loop to generate responsive thumbnail grids. Here's an example leveraging Breakpoint Slicer, a syntactic sugar for Breakpoint:
=responsive-span($start-cols: 1, $start-slice: 1, $guts: 0.1)
@for $i from 1 through (total-slices() - $start-slice + 1)
$slice: $start-slice + $i - 1
$cols: $start-cols + $i - 1
+at($slice)
+quick-span($cols, $guts)
A single call of this mixin results in a full-fledged responsive thumbnail grid!
.column
+responsive-span
